Hi, yes, it's possible for some months to be worse than others. I didn't have much period pain, but every so often I would have a really bad period, where the pain would come on suddenly and would leave me doubled over. What kind of pain are you experiencing?

My symptoms start 4 + days before my period. Extreme lower back pain and thigh pain, some days to the point its painful to walk. Mild cramping during this time. Once my period begins the cramps are pretty extreme. I take so much ibuprofen just so I'm semi functional. Fatigue, its drains me. Sex can be uncomfortable during and cramping after for a few days or more. Bowel issues most months before and during. Ovulation (I think) causes cramping and sharp pains. My doctor suggested a hyterectomy (Uterus only hopefully) not so much for the endo but the enlarged/prolapse of the uterus and said he will look and remove any endometriosis during the hyterectomy. They will also be placing a midurethal sling due to bladder issues during this procedure as well. I just wanted to get a point of view from someone else experiencing the same things. I'm a little nervous about the procedures. Most months are pretty terrible but this month although still pretty uncomfortable nothing like last month.
